Printable thermo-optic polymer switches utilizing imprinting and ink-jet printing |
Optics Express, Vol. 21, Issue 2, pp. 2110-2117 (2013)
http://dx.doi.org/10.1364/OE.21.002110
Acrobat PDF (2732 KB)
Abstract
We demonstrate a printable Thermo-Optic (TO) switch utilizing imprinting and ink-jet printing techniques. The material system, optical and thermal designs are discussed. Imprinting technique is used to transfer a 2 × 2 switch pattern from a flexible mold into a UV15LV polymer bottom cladding. Ink-jet printing is further used to deposit a SU-8 polymer core layer on top. Operation of the switch is experimentally demonstrated up to a frequency of 1 kHz, with switching time less than 0.5ms. The printing technique demonstrates great potential for high throughput, roll-to-roll fabrication of low cost photonic devices.
